Dax Olav; The Most Adorkable Dog You're Likely to Meet!

Species:
Genetically Uplifted Mutt ( 1/4 Collie, 1/4 Labrador, 1/2 German Shepherd)
Age: Mid 20s
Eyes: Amber
Height: 6'2"
Build: Gangly/Lanky. Long fingers and seemingly big foot-paws, too. If you've ever seen an adolescent puppy whose paws are still too big for the rest of them, Dax gives that effect.
Fur/Marking: Dax's patterns seem to follow those of his 'classic collie' father, however his cheeks and flanks are German Shepherd buff rather then Collie white. The general length and flow of his fur also tend to lean more towards the Collie side, however he does possess the pronounced cheek-ruffs of a German Shepherd and a somewhat thicker, fluffier fur on his chest and stomach. The other distinctive feature is a 'lop' left ear, a call-back to his Labrador grandfather..

History: Dax is the son of Conner and Trix Olav, whose details and story can be found elsewhere on these pages. Due to complications bought about by old battle injuries, Dax and his mother, Trix, nearly died during his birth. Fortunately, the two excellent biologists on hand were able to save the mother, aided by her considerable natural toughness, however the strain of the event left Dax severely weakened, with organs barely able to keep the puppy alive and even then at a constant risk of failing for good. The surgeons decided to operate, working against the clock to graft a range of small machines into the puppy that would support and regulate his failing internal organs. For several tense weeks, it was touch and go.. however, gradually, the puppy grew stronger and stronger, coming out of the danger area to the great relief of his parents, the other pack members and, of course, the surgical team who'd fought so hard to save his life.

Talents:
Technomancy: Normally, Professor Olav's genetically engineered canids develop a certain degree of 'Pack' telepathy between them, as well being born with shapeshifting skills. The surgery as a puppy precludes Dax from shapeshifting and, subsequently, the telepathy that normally would enable the dogs to communicate with feral mouths was assumed to be latent or lost entirely. However, at around the time that the other elevated canids were beginning to develop their telepathy and truly master their shapeshifting, Dax began to demonstrate an affinity for machines, initially being able to create words on the screens of suitable devices using his mind rather then a keyboard. This talent evolved as he grew, evolving into an ability to reprogram nearby electronics with a thought, then an ability to re-shape and re-purpose machines which he had contact with. Whether this is the absolute end of his skills remains to be seen...
To recap, this skill covers:
* Virtual Interfacing: with machines nearby, allowing him to 'talk' to computers and machinery the way his pack would talk to each other with telepathy. In turn this allows him to reprogram some devices merely by mentally visualizing and thinking about the result he desires.
* Wireless Link: Related to the above, Dax's mind is capable of connecting into local internet sources and extracting data from them. He's also capable of controlling wireless-connect machinery with his mind, particularly when the machinery is one of the range of small drones or robots he's created over the years. Including that one that Just Serves Butter.
* Machine Reform: Dax can reform machines and metalwork he touches again by simply thinking about what he desires the outcome to be and focusing on the matter for a while.

Partial Magical Anomaly: Due to being bonded to Machinery, Dax has something of an odd relationship with 'magic' and some other mental effects that tend to misbehave when trying to effect him. This is particularly true of telepathy, a fact that frustrates him no end as it means he can't tap in to his own families Pack telepathy and communicate with them.

Swimming: Is part Labrador. Go figure.

Personality:
For the most part, a big softy with a chilled out nature and a heart of gold who only wants those around him to be happy.
The only exceptions to this are when he's tinkering with machinery, in which case he tends to zone out of the real world almost entirely, or if someone is hurt in front of him. Then the fiercely protective nature inherited from his mother kicks in...

Stray Notes:
* Due to his grandfather being a Labrador, Dax has webbed toes, a feature developed in the breed to aid in their roll of recovering game from water.
* Tends to talk a lot, generally saying out loud the thoughts passing through his head until he reaches some kind of internal consensus or realizes what he's doing.
